Tissue Expression Profile and Cellular Localization of PHGPx in Gonad of Goat

Abstract:

【Objective】 The objectives of this study were to evaluate the expression pattern of PHGPx in various tissues and localization of PHGPx in gonad of goat. 【Method】 Total RNA was isolated from various tissues, and mRNA expression was detected by real-time fluorescent quantitative PCR. Cellular localization of PHGPx in testes and epididymidis was examined by immunohistochemistry, respectively. 【Result】 The quantitative real-time PCR results showed that the rank order of PHGPx mRNA expression was testes>>heart>cerebrum>epididymidis>kidney>liver>lung>spleen>Longissimus dorsi (LD) muscle, and testes>>epididymidis tail (EpT)>epididymidis head (EpH)>epididymidis body (EpB). There was a positive expression of PHGPx in interstitial tissue and spermatogenic cells of caprine testes. The expression of PHGPx in smooth muscle fibers (SMF) of EpB showed a weak positive signal, and simple columnar epithelium (SCE) around the ductus epididymidis (DE) of EpT showed a strong positive products. 【Conclusion】 Goat PHGPx mRNA appeared to be ubiquitously expressed almost in all tissues, which plays an important biological function. The immunohistochemistry results display the differently expressed region evidently between testes and epididymidis. Furthermore, the mechanism of dramaticly expressed in gonad needs to be further researched.

Key words: phospholipid hydroperoxide glutathione peroxidase (PHGPx), fluorescent quantitative PCR, tissue distribution, testes, epididymidis
